About The Position

SOTI is committed to providing its employees with endless possibilities; learning new things, working with the latest technologies and making a difference in the world. We are seeking a pragmatic Senior Data Science Manager to lead the development and delivery of AI-driven product capabilities that create measurable value for our customers and business. In this role, you will combine technical depth with strategic leadership, transforming data into actionable insights and scalable product features. You will collaborate closely with cross-functional teams across engineering and product to design, build, and deploy reliable AI solutions that integrate seamlessly into our platform. This position requires a hands-on leader who thrives in fast-paced product environments, prioritizing practical, real-world impact and iterative delivery over theoretical experimentation. You will also play a key role in mentoring and growing a high-performing team of data scientists and engineers, fostering a culture that balances analytical rigor with strong engineering practices.

Requirements

  • Advanced degree in computer science, data science, statistics, or a related quantitative field, or equivalent practical experience in applying AI/ML to product environments.
  • 8+ years of experience in data science, machine learning engineering, or applied AI roles, with a proven track record of shipping AI-driven features in production products.
  • 4+ years of experience managing and mentoring teams of data scientists, ML engineers, and developers in tech-driven organizations.
  • Strong hands-on programming skills in Python, SQL, and related tools, with experience building and deploying models, data pipelines, and analytical systems in cloud environments (e.g., AWS, Azure).
  • Expertise in pragmatic AI applications such as machine learning, time-series analysis, anomaly detection, user modeling, or predictive analytics, with a focus on product integration rather than research.
  • Demonstrated ability to lead combined data science and development efforts, synthesizing diverse data sources into actionable, business-impacting insights.
  • Excellent communication skills for bridging technical and non-technical audiences, including product managers, engineers, and executives.
  • Solid understanding of MLOps, scalable data architectures, and deployment patterns, with experience in monitoring and iterating on production AI systems.
  • Experience defining team standards and processes for embedding AI into products, emphasizing speed, reliability, and customer value.

Responsibilities

  • Lead the design, development, and deployment of AI and machine learning systems, including scalable pipelines for inference, analytics, and real-time processing, using modern engineering practices to ensure robustness and efficiency.
  • Collaborate with product management, development, and business teams to identify and solve product challenges through data-driven models, focusing on user behavior, predictive analytics, and operational improvements.
  • Oversee hands-on prototyping, experimentation, and iteration to validate AI solutions quickly, translating complex data insights into clear product recommendations that influence strategy and priorities.
  • Establish and enforce best practices for AI operations, including data quality, model monitoring, and cross-team collaboration to maintain high performance in production.
  • Build and mentor a high-performing team of data scientists and developers, promoting a culture of ownership, innovation, and product-oriented thinking while fostering skills in both data analysis and software engineering.
  • Partner with stakeholders to propose AI initiatives that align with business goals, driving measurable outcomes like enhanced customer experiences and optimized operations.
  • Contribute directly to code and system architecture, ensuring your team delivers production-ready solutions that leverage cloud-based tools and integrate with existing development workflows.
